Foldable swing

By designing a foldable swing, the swing seat is connected by a support frame and suspension components, enabling quick folding. This solves the problems of existing swing chairs being bulky and complicated to assemble and disassemble, avoids the loss of parts, and improves the convenience and comfort of use.

AI Technical Summary

Technical Problem

Existing swing chairs occupy a large area, take a long time to install, and the increased number of disassembly and assembly operations leads to a decrease in the tightness of parts and a risk of losing small parts.

Method used

Design a foldable swing with a swing seat connected by a support frame and a suspension component. The support frame includes a first support rod, a second support rod, and a connecting rod. The swing seat includes a backrest frame and a seat cushion frame. The support rods are foldable, and the backrest frame and seat cushion frame are hinged. Quick folding is achieved using the connecting rod, connecting buckle, and suspension component.

Benefits of technology

It enables quick folding of the swing chair, simplifies operation, avoids loss of parts, reduces weight, and maintains comfort.

Description

TECHNICAL FIELD

[0001] The utility model relates to a swing technical field, especially a foldable swing. BACKGROUND

[0002] The swing chair is a kind of household supplies.With the improvement of living standards,more and more people put swing chairs in the patio or garden at home,can ride swing chair in leisure time,relieve stress and keep comfortable mood.The existing swing is generally full disassembly,occupies larger area,installation time is longer,if it is necessary to store,needs to be completely disassembled,convenient for next use,increases disassembly times,will cause the fastening effect of part to reduce,there is the risk of small part loss simultaneously. CONTENT OF UTILITY MODEL

[0003] The utility model aims at solving the technical insufficiency of the above-mentioned and designs a foldable swing.

[0004] The utility model designs a foldable swing, which comprises:

[0005] A swing seat,

[0006] A support frame is located on both sides of the swing seat, and

[0007] A hanging piece is connected to the support frame by the swing seat.

[0008] The support frame comprises a first support rod, a second support rod and a connecting rod, the first support rod and the second support rod are hingedly connected, and the two ends of the connecting rod are connected to the first support rod and the second support rod respectively and deviate from the hinge point, so as to limit the unfolding angle of the first support rod and the second support rod. The swing seat comprises a backrest frame and a cushion frame, and the backrest frame is hingedly connected to the cushion frame.

[0009] The foldable swing has an unfolded state and a folded state. In the unfolded state, the first support rod and the second support rod are unfolded by rotating around the hinge point, and the backrest frame and the cushion frame form an unfolded seat state. In the folded state, the first support rod and the second support rod are nearly overlapped, and the backrest frame and the cushion frame are folded.

[0010] As preferred, the backrest frame is located at the back side of the cushion frame, the two ends of the backrest frame extend forward to form armrest frames, a second connecting member is arranged between the top end of the armrest frame and the cushion frame, a connecting hole is arranged on the cushion frame, the second connecting member is fixedly connected to the connecting hole through a bolt, the end of the armrest frame is hingedly connected to the second connecting member, so that the backrest frame and the armrest frame can be relatively folded with the cushion frame, and flexible supporting materials are arranged between the backrest frame and the cushion frame, between the armrest frame and the cushion frame, and in the cushion frame as supporting surfaces.

[0011] Further optimization, the two ends of the armrest frame are respectively provided with first carabiners, the first supporting rod and the second supporting rod are respectively provided with second carabiners, the hanging member includes four hanging rods, and hooks are formed at the two ends of each hanging rod. The two hanging rods on the same side are respectively connected to the corresponding first carabiners through the hooks at one end, and are respectively connected to the second carabiners on the first supporting rod and the second supporting rod through the hooks at the other end.

[0012] As preferred, the two ends of the connecting rod are respectively provided with gourd holes, the first supporting rod and the second supporting rod are provided with clamping columns matched with the gourd holes in a plug-in manner, the gourd holes are provided with connecting buckles through fasteners, the connecting buckles are provided with limiting holes for limiting the clamping columns, and springs are arranged between the fasteners and the connecting buckles.

[0013] Further optimization, the end of the connecting rod is flat, the connecting buckle is tightly attached to the end of the connecting rod, and the edges of the connecting buckle are bent to form a limit on both sides of the end of the connecting rod.

[0014] Further optimization, the connecting rod is divided into a first rod part and a second rod part, one end of the first rod part and the second rod part is connected to the first supporting rod and the second supporting rod respectively, and the other end is provided with a first connecting member. The first connecting member is open at both ends, the ends of the first rod part and the second rod part are respectively inserted into the openings of the first connecting member and are hingedly connected to the first connecting member through positioning pins, and an active gap is left between the end of the first rod part, the end of the second rod part and the inner wall of the first connecting member. An opening is formed in communication on one side of the first connecting member, and the opening is downwardly arranged.

[0015] As preferred, a transverse supporting rod is arranged between the two second supporting rods, the two ends of the transverse supporting rod are provided with insertion pieces, and positioning parts are arranged on the two second supporting rods. An insertion slot is arranged on the positioning part and used for downwardly inserting the insertion piece, a screw hole is arranged on the positioning part and communicated with the insertion slot, a locking bolt is screwed into the screw hole, the top of the locking bolt is tightly abutted to the surface of the insertion piece to lock the insertion piece, the positioning part is a bent plate structure, a gap is formed after the positioning part is bent to serve as the insertion slot, and the positioning part is integrally arranged with the second supporting rod.

[0016] Further optimization, the number of transverse support rods is two or more, which are arranged in parallel along the length direction of the second support rod on the second support rod.

[0017] As preferred, a first mounting rod is arranged between the top ends of the two first support rods, and a second mounting rod is arranged between the top ends of the two second support rods, the second mounting rod and the first mounting rod are arranged in front and back, and a ceiling is arranged between the second mounting rod and the first mounting rod.

[0018] Further optimization, the two ends of the first mounting rod are respectively detachably inserted into the top ends of the two first support rods, and the two ends of the second mounting rod are respectively detachably inserted into the top ends of the two second support rods.

[0019] The technical effect of the utility model is that the two sides of the swing seat are respectively provided with support frames, each support frame comprises a first support rod and a second support rod, the same side first support rod and second support rod are crossly and rearwardly hinged, the lower parts of the first support rod and the second support rod are provided with a connecting rod which can be downwardly bent to form a folding, so that the two support rods can be quickly folded, the swing seat comprises a backrest frame, a handrail frame and a cushion frame, the backrest frame and the handrail frame are integrated, and the cushion frame is hinged between the integrated backrest frame and handrail frame to realize folding, therefore, the whole swing can be quickly folded, the operation is simple and direct, and there are no scattered parts, the support rod, the connecting rod, the transverse support rod, the backrest frame, the handrail frame and the cushion frame are all hollow pipe body structures, so that the overall weight of the swing seat is lighter, the backrest frame, the handrail frame and the cushion frame are formed by surrounding the hollow pipe body, the backrest surface and the cushion surface are formed by connecting the flexible support material to the hollow pipe body and tightening, which not only reduces the overall weight to the maximum extent, but also ensures the comfort, and the whole can be folded without disassembling fasteners or parts, so that the problem of unable folding or normal use caused by part loss is avoided. DETAILED DESCRIPTION

[0032] The technical scheme in the embodiments of the utility model will be described clearly and completely in combination with the drawings in the embodiments of the utility model, obviously, the described embodiments are only part of the embodiments of the utility model, not all the embodiments. Based on the embodiments in the utility model, all other embodiments obtained by the person skilled in the art belong to the protection scope of the utility model.

[0033] As Figures 1-8As shown, a foldable swing includes a support frame 2 and a swing seat 1. The swing seat 1 is connected to the support frame 2 via a suspension member 3. Support frames 2 are respectively provided on the left and right sides of the swing seat 1. Each support frame 2 includes a first support rod 21, a second support rod 22, and a connecting rod 4. The first support rod 21 and the second support rod 22 are hinged to each other, so that the first support rod 21 and the second support rod 22 can rotate around the hinge point to achieve folding. The two ends of the connecting rod 4 are respectively connected to the first support rod 21 and the second support rod 22 to limit the unfolding angle between the first support rod 21 and the second support rod 22.

[0034] Preferably, in this embodiment, the connecting rod 4 is located below the hinge point of the first support rod 21 and the second support rod 22.

[0035] like Figures 2-5 As shown, the connecting rod 4 is laterally located between the first support rod 21 and the second support rod 22. The two ends of the connecting rod 4 are movably connected to the first support rod 21 and the second support rod 22, respectively. Each end of the connecting rod 4 is provided with a gourd hole 4-5, which is also laterally arranged. The gourd hole 4-5 includes two holes with different diameters that are connected. The first support rod 21 and the second support rod 22 are provided with a locking post 4-6. The locking post 4-6 is inserted into the hole with the larger diameter and then slides into the hole with the smaller diameter, so that the locking post 4-6 and the hole with the smaller diameter form a limiting fit, thereby restricting the connecting rod 4 from displacing outward and thus preventing it from coming off.

[0036] In this embodiment, the end of the connecting rod 4 is flat, which facilitates the locking of the hoist hole 4-5 and the snap-fit ​​post 4-6. The connecting rod 4 is also provided with an installation hole, and a connecting buckle 4-7 is also fitted at the end of the connecting rod 4. The connecting buckle 4-7 is provided with a threaded hole, and a fastener 4-9, such as a screw or bolt, is provided in the threaded hole. After the fastener 4-9 passes through the threaded hole, it is inserted into the installation hole, so that the connecting buckle 4-7 can be detachably connected to the end of the connecting rod 4. A limiting hole 4-8 is provided on the connecting buckle 4-7. The limiting hole 4-8 is aligned with the smaller diameter hole at the end of the connecting rod 4. When the connecting buckle 4-7 is connected to the end of the connecting rod 4, the top of the snap-fit ​​post 4-6 is exactly located in the limiting hole 4-8 to form a limit and prevent the snap-fit ​​post 4-6 from sliding to the larger hole of the hoist hole 4-5, thus fixing the end of the connecting rod 4 to the corresponding support rod. Preferably, the fastener 4-9 passes through the connecting buckle 4-7 and is fastened in the mounting hole on the connecting rod 4, while the spring 4-10 abuts between the cap of the connecting buckle 4-7 and the fastener 4-9, so that the connecting buckle 4-7 is initially attached to the end of the connecting rod 4. Applying force to the connecting buckle 4-7 can cause it to move outward, thereby separating the limiting hole 4-8 from the locking post 4-6, and then allowing the locking post 4-6 to be dislodged from the hoist hole 4-5, realizing the quick disassembly or installation between the connecting rod 4 and the first support rod 21 or the second support rod 22.

[0037] In the embodiment, the connecting buckle 4-7 is a flat plate structure, and the two opposite edges of the connecting buckle 4-7 are bent to form bent portions 4-11. The two bent portions 4-11 are just buckled and limited on both sides of the end portion of the connecting rod 4. That is, through the bent portions 4-11, the connecting buckle 4-7 and the connecting rod 4 are longitudinally limited, so that the connecting buckle 4-7 cannot be deviated at will, and the connecting life between the connecting buckle 4-7 and the connecting rod 4 is prolonged.

[0038] Further, the connecting rod 4 is broken in the middle to form a first rod 4-1 and a second rod 4-2. The outer ends of the first rod 4-1 and the second rod 4-2 are respectively connected to the first support rod 21 and the second support rod 22, and the inner ends thereof are connected to each other through a first connecting piece 4-3. The first connecting piece 4-3 is open at both ends, and the inner ends of the first rod 4-1 and the second rod 4-2 are respectively inserted into the openings of the first connecting piece 4-3 and are hingedly connected to the first connecting piece 4-3 through positioning pins 4-12.

[0039] In the embodiment, the first connecting piece 4-3 is a U-shaped piece, and the end portions of the first rod 4-1 and the second rod 4-2 are movably connected in a hoop type. The end portions of the first rod 4-1 and the second rod 4-2 and the inner wall of the first connecting piece 4-3 are left with a movable gap therebetween, so that the first rod 4-1 and the second rod 4-2 are folded by rotating along the first connecting piece 4-3. An opening 4-4 is formed on one side of the first connecting piece 4-3 and communicates with the opening. The opening 4-4 is downwardly arranged, so that the first rod 4-1 and the second rod 4-2 can only be folded downwardly. In this way, the first connecting piece 4-3 limits the upward rotation of the connecting rod 4, avoids the upward folding of the connecting rod 4 to make the first connecting piece 4-3 contact the ground, and improves the stability of the connecting rod 4 in the unfolded state.

[0040] The two second support rods 22 are provided with a transverse support rod 5 therebetween. The transverse support rod 5 is provided with an insertion piece 5-1 at both ends thereof. The insertion piece 5-1 is downwardly arranged and integrally connected to the transverse support rod 5. The insertion piece 5-1 is a sheet structure with a relatively thin thickness. The two second support rods 22 are respectively provided with a positioning portion 6. The positioning portion 6 is a flat block structure and is integrally connected to the support rod. The positioning portion 6 is provided with an insertion slot 6-1. The opening of the insertion slot 6-1 is upwardly arranged. When the insertion piece 5-1 of the transverse support rod 5 is inserted into the insertion slot 6-1 from the opening downwardly, the transverse support rod 5 and the second support rod 22 are connected. The positioning portion 6 is provided with a threaded hole 6-2. The threaded hole 6-2 communicates with the insertion slot 6-1. A locking bolt 6-3 is screwed in the threaded hole 6-2. The top of the locking bolt 6-3 tightly abuts against the surface of the insertion piece 5-1 to lock the insertion piece 5-1, so as to lock the insertion piece 5-1 and the positioning portion 6. The transverse support rod 5 and the second support rod 22 are stably and detachably connected.

[0041] Preferably, the bottom end of the insertion piece 5-1 is fixedly connected with the transverse support rod 5, and the top end of the insertion piece 5-1 has a length smaller than that of the bottom end, which serves as a guide for the insertion of the top end of the insertion piece 5-1 from the opening, and the insertion piece 5-1 can be more stably inserted into the insertion slot 6-1.

[0042] Preferably, the positioning part 6 is a bent plate, which is bent to form two parts, and a gap is formed between the two parts as the insertion slot 6-1. The bent plate is integrally connected with the second support rod 22 on one side, and the structure of the bent plate reduces the thickness of the folded structure.

[0043] Preferably, the number of the transverse support rods 5 is two or more, which are arranged in parallel along the length direction of the second support rod 22, that is, distributed along the up-down direction of the second support rod 22, thereby strengthening the stability between the two second support rods 22.

[0044] In the embodiment, the swing seat 1 comprises a backrest frame 1-1 and a cushion frame 1-2, the backrest frame 1-1 is located at the rear side of the cushion frame 1-2, and both the backrest frame 1-1 and the cushion frame 1-2 are formed by enclosing a pipe body structure. The two ends of the backrest frame 1-1 extend forward and are bent downward to form an armrest frame 1-3, that is, the backrest frame 1-1 and the armrest frame 1-3 are integrally formed. A second connecting piece 1-4 is arranged between the top end of the armrest frame 1-3 and the cushion frame 1-2. A connecting hole 1-5 is arranged on the cushion frame 1-2, and the second connecting piece 1-4 is fixedly connected to the connecting hole 1-5 by a bolt. The second connecting piece 1-4 and the cushion frame 1-2 are fixedly connected, the second connecting piece 1-4 is a U-shaped piece, and the opening of the second connecting piece 1-4 is hingedly connected with the end of the armrest frame 1-3, so that the backrest frame 1-1 and the armrest frame 1-3 can be folded relative to the cushion frame 1-2.

[0045] Flexible support material 1-6 is arranged between the backrest frame 1-1 and the cushion frame 1-2 and between the armrest frame 1-3 and the cushion frame 1-2 as a backrest surface. The flexible support material 1-6 can be deformed at will, which is conducive to the folding of the swing and can also reduce the weight.

[0046] The armrest frame 1-3 is provided with a first hook ring 7 at both ends, and a second hook ring 8 is provided on the first support rod 21 and the second support rod 22. The first hook ring 7 and the second hook ring 8 are fixed to the armrest frame 1-3 and the support rod by welding. The suspension component 3 includes four hanging rods 31, each hanging rod 31 forming a hook at both ends. The hanging rods 31 are distributed in pairs on both sides of the swing seat 1. One end of the hook of the two hanging rods 31 on the same side is hooked to the corresponding first hook ring 7, and the other end is hooked to the second hook ring 8 on the first support rod 21 and the second support rod 22, respectively. That is, the armrest frame 1-3 is suspended to the first support rod 21 and the second support rod 22 by hooks, which improves the connection stability between the swing seat 1 and the support rod, making the whole swing more stable.

[0047] A first mounting rod 10 is provided between the top ends of the two first support rods 21, and a second mounting rod 11 is provided between the top ends of the two second support rods 22. The second mounting rod 11 and the first mounting rod 10 are arranged in a front-to-back manner, and both the second mounting rod 11 and the first mounting rod 10 are in a bent state so that a canopy 12 is provided between the second mounting rod 11 and the first mounting rod 10.

[0048] The foldable swing has an unfolded state and a folded state. In the unfolded state, as... Figure 1 As shown, the first support rod 21 and the second support rod 22 rotate around the hinge point until they unfold relative to each other. Then, the backrest frame 1-1 and the seat cushion frame 1-2 also unfold relative to each other around the second connector 1-4 to form a seat. At this time, the connecting rod 4 is in a straight state, and both ends of the connecting rod 4 are connected to the first support rod 21 and the second support rod 22 via connecting buckles 4-7. At this time, the first mounting rod 10 and the second mounting rod 11 unfold with the first support rod 21 and the second support rod 22 respectively. In the folded state, as... Figure 7 As shown, the first support rod 21 and the second support rod 22 rotate around the hinge point to form a folded or nearly folded state. Then, the backrest frame 1-1 and the seat cushion frame 1-2 rotate around their corresponding hinge points to form a folded or nearly folded state. At this time, by adjusting the connecting buckle 407, the two ends of the connecting rod 4 are made movable with the corresponding support rod, so that when the two support rods rotate relative to each other, the connecting rod 4 simultaneously rotates around the first connecting member 4-3 to form a folded state. Figure 8 As shown, the final result is that folds are formed between the first support rod 21 and the second support rod 22, and between the backrest frame 1-1 and the seat cushion frame 1-2.

[0049] Furthermore, the two ends of the first mounting rod 10 are respectively inserted into the top ends of the two first support rods 21, and the two ends of the second mounting rod 11 are respectively inserted into the top ends of the two second support rods 22. The mounting rod and the support rod are sleeved together and are limited by elastic pins. When disassembly is required, the mounting rod and the support rod can be separated simply by pressing the elastic pins.

[0050] Another embodiment, as shown in FIG. 1, the flexible support material 1-6 is a cloth tape 1-9, one end of which is wound and connected to the backrest frame 1-1 and the armrest frame 1-3, and the other end is wound and connected to the cushion frame 1-2; the front and rear sides of the cushion frame 1-2 are also detachably connected with horizontal rods 1-7, and between the two horizontal rods 1-7, there is a cloth tape 1-9 or a cloth surface 1-8, the front and rear ends of which are wound and connected to the corresponding horizontal rods 1-7, so that the cushion surface formed by the two horizontal rods 1-7 can be assembled or disassembled as a whole, which is very convenient.
